Subject: Key rotation for InvoiceForge renderer

Welcome, new folks. Every quarter we rotate the credential the Pellworth PDF invoice renderer uses to call our internal asset service, Vaultline. The old key stops working Friday at noon. Update your local .env and the staging config before then, and verify a test invoice renders with the new embedded fonts. For convenience, the freshly issued key is included here.

app token of bagef-bageg = kto11_vuwA0uhrEMg

## Runbook: Gaugepile Sidecar — Release Checklist

Heads up: the sidecar ships with every app pod, so a bad config fans out fast. Before cutting a release, confirm the flush interval hasn't drifted from what the Tallyhouse aggregator expects, or you'll see sawtooth gaps in dashboards. Rollbacks are cheap — just repin the image tag. Canary one node pool first, watch for ten minutes, then proceed. The values to verify against are these.

config for bagep-yafof:
quenath:
  pin: 8584
  metrics_host: metrics.quenath.tolvaqsys.internal
  tenant: pelath
  seal: seal_ed102645

Subject: Audit-log viewer — getting you set up

Hi folks,

Welcome aboard! Quick orientation on LedgerLens, our audit-log viewer, for the Quillmark integration. The sandbox mirrors production schemas, so queries you build there will port over cleanly. Filters on actor and timestamp are indexed; everything else is slow, so be patient with free-text search. Docs are in the shared wiki under "LedgerLens basics." To hit the sandbox API, authenticate with the bearer token below.

session JWT of kadug-bagep = eyJhbGciOiJIUzI1NiIsInR5cCI6IkpXVCJ9.eyJzdWIiOiIBYcthNIn0.Sy9ajSzn

Postmortem: the Lanternbox cache layer served stale pricing for 40 minutes after a failed invalidation fanout. Root cause: the Quillware purge worker silently dropped auth failures. Fix shipped in 4.2.1. If customers report stale data, trigger a manual purge via the internal flush endpoint. The purge endpoint requires the support-tier key, which is provided below.

gateway credential: kto3_qfe